Kind of disappointing. Go is just such a boring non-character that even the animators don't bother showing his captures anymore, they know we won't see 90% of them ever again anyway so it's pointless. At least they remembered the Kalos tradition of putting most of Ash's battles in big tournaments off-screen. We could have of course had some stuff with Riolu battling or Gengar doing some good stuff instead of just losing to Korrina, but I guess they really needed to shove Korrina's granddad in the episode, despite him adding nothing to the plot, not even a gag. I don't mind character interactions, if they're actually funny, interesting, or add something to the plot or characters. But Korrina's granddad added nothing.

Then they establish Korrina also wanting to increase her ranking and battle Leon, and here I am thinking after 23 seasons they finally introduced a female rival for Ash, and then they have her lose already in their first battle of this series, which isn't exactly a great omen for a future rivalry. Usually at least Ash starts on the backfoot and at a disadvantage, like how he was totally overpowered by Gladion when he was introduced. Granted, it was a close battle, but still. I don't think either Go nor Ash gets enough conflict in this series, Ash hasn't lost anything since Leon and has already reached super rank, while Go gets tons of pokémon with no fanfare and 9 out of 10 times he doesn't even have to weaken them first. It just gets repetitive. At least Ash has the advantage that some of the battles they actually bother to show on-screen still look good, none of Go's captures since Golurk have been interesting in any way and the Golurk capture was kind of a cheat as Ash weakened it beforehand.
